How Common Is The Last Name Stroum?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 2,091,648th most commonly occurring surname internationally, borne by approximately 1 in 89,969,703 people. This surname is mostly found in The Americas, where 85 percent of Stroum live; 85 percent live in North America and 85 percent live in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most widely held in The United States, where it is held by 78 people, or 1 in 4,646,909. In The United States Stroum is most frequent in: Washington, where 28 percent are found, Florida, where 15 percent are found and Massachusetts, where 15 percent are found. Outside of The United States this last name is found in 3 countries. It also occurs in France, where 1 percent are found and Luxembourg, where 1 percent are found.
